Learn why accounting and finance matters and the key ideas in an easy-to-digest form Accounting and Finance for Non-Accounting Students, 11th edition provides a clearly explained introduction to the key ideas of accounting and finance in the business world, and why these matter. Assuming you have no previous knowledge of the subject, this book uses clear, accessible language, and makes frequent connections to real-life finance issues to bring the subject to life. The textbook provides information in a bitesize way and uses everyday examples of finance decisions like spending on coffee, saving or investing, and the impact of those decisions on personal wealth, to help you grasp the essential concepts before exploring them in the context of companies later in the book. This innovative approach will help prepare you with a solid grounding in the fundamentals that you'll need for your university education and in your career.
